PoE+ (802.3at) extends the original PoE standard (802.3af) from 15.4W to 30W per port, supporting higher-powered devices such as IP PTZ cameras, advanced access points, and full-featured IP door entry stations. The TL-SG1008MP provides PoE+ on all eight ports rather than a subset, meaning every connected device has access to the full 30W individual port budget.
The 153W total PoE budget covers up to eight devices at typical PoE camera and access point power draws: a standard IP dome camera typically draws 6-12W, an access point 15-20W, and a PoE access control reader 3-5W. A mixed installation of cameras and access points can comfortably operate within the 153W total budget.
Unmanaged operation means no configuration is required: connect power, connect the uplink to the network router or managed switch, and connect PoE devices to the remaining ports. All devices receive IP addresses from the network DHCP server and are immediately reachable on the network.
This is a significantly more capable product than the TL-SG105 (5-port non-PoE, also in this range): the SG1008MP provides eight ports and full PoE+ powering for all connected devices, making it the appropriate choice for security and network installations where cameras and other powered devices need both data and power from the switch.
For desktop placement the unit fits on a shelf; rack ears are included for 19-inch rack mounting.
